Subject: [RFC PATCH 04/11] mm/damon/sysfs-schemes: implement path file under quota goal directory
Date: Thu, 19 Jun 2025 15:00:16 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250619220023.24023-5-sj@k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20250619220023.24023-1-sj@kernel.org>
Add a DAMOS sysfs file for specifying the cgroup of the interest for
DAMOS_QUOTA_NODE_MEMCG_USED_BP.

diff --git a/mm/damon/sysfs-schemes.c b/mm/damon/sysfs-schemes.c
index 4805761d9127..4a340baa72a4 100644
--- a/mm/damon/sysfs-schemes.c
+++ b/mm/damon/sysfs-schemes.c
@@ -999,6 +999,7 @@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al {
unsigned long target_value;
unsigned long current_value;
int nid;
+ char *path;
};
static stru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al *damos_sysfs_quota_goal_alloc(void)
@@ -1132,10 +1133,39 @@ static ssize_t nid_store(struct kobject *kobj,
return err ? err : count;
}
+static ssize_t path_show(struct kobject *kobj,
+ struct kobj_attribute *attr, char *buf)
+{
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al *goal = container_of(kobj,
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al, kobj);
+
+ return sysfs_emit(buf, "%s\n", goal->path ? goal->path : "");
+}
+
+static ssize_t path_store(struct kobject *kobj,
+ struct kobj_attribute *attr, const char *buf, size_t count)
+{
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al *goal = container_of(kobj,
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al, kobj);
+ char *path = kmalloc_array(size_add(count, 1), sizeof(*path),
+ GFP_KERNEL);
+
+ if (!path)
+ return -ENOMEM;
+
+ strscpy(path, buf, count + 1);
+ kfree(goal->path);
+ goal->path = path;
+ return count;
+}
+
static void damos_sysfs_quota_goal_release(struct kobject *kobj)
{
- /* or, notify this release to the feed callback */
- kfree(container_of(kobj, stru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al, kobj));
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al *goal = container_of(kobj,
+ struct damos_sysfs_quota_goal, kobj);
+
+ kfree(goal->path);
+ kfree(goal);
}
static struct kobj_attribute damos_sysfs_quota_goal_target_metric_attr =
@@ -1150,11 +1180,15 @@ static struct kobj_attribute damos_sysfs_quota_goal_current_value_attr =
static struct kobj_attribute damos_sysfs_quota_goal_nid_attr =
__ATTR_RW_MODE(nid, 0600);
+static struct kobj_attribute damos_sysfs_quota_goal_path_attr =
+ __ATTR_RW_MODE(path, 0600);
+
static struct attribute *damos_sysfs_quota_goal_attrs[] = {
&damos_sysfs_quota_goal_target_metric_attr.attr,
&damos_sysfs_quota_goal_target_value_attr.attr,
&damos_sysfs_quota_goal_current_value_attr.attr,
&damos_sysfs_quota_goal_nid_attr.attr,
+ &damos_sysfs_quota_goal_path_attr.attr,
NULL,
};
ATTRIBUTE_GROUPS(damos_sysfs_quota_goal);
